
The Dodge Journey has finally become a worthy rival for mainstream crossovers like the Equinox, RAV4 and CR-V.
The Kia Sorento is the Journey's closest competitor, with seating for seven, a choice of four- or six- cylinder engines, and an easy-to-use UVO voice control system for phone, audio, and navigation.
The Honda CR-V is well-packaged, refined and known for its reliability, and the Chevy Equinox offers extra interior space and up to 32 mpg on the highway.
The Toyota RAV4 only offers two rows of seats and a four-cylinder engine, while the Subaru Outback puts a focus on adventure-prone families with its added levels of ruggedness.
The Journey is also about the same size and shape as the Toyota Venza, but its superior packaging and third available third row create more usable space than in the Toyota.
